Raw veganism is a dietary lifestyle that involves consuming uncooked and unprocessed plant-based foods. It focuses on the belief that heating food above 118°F destroys its natural enzymes, nutrients, and health benefits. 1. Raw Vegan Pizza: Who said pizza can’t be healthy? This recipe replaces the traditional dough with a crust made from nuts and seeds, topped with fresh vegetables and a savory tomato sauce.
2. Zucchini Noodles with Pesto: Spiralized zucchini is used as a substitute for pasta in this recipe. Toss it with a delicious homemade pesto sauce made from basil, garlic, pine nuts, and olive oil.
3. Raw Vegan Chocolate Mousse: Indulge your sweet tooth guilt-free with this decadent chocolate mousse made from avocados, cacao powder, and natural sweeteners like dates or maple syrup.
4. Raw Vegan Sushi Rolls: Enjoy the flavors of sushi without the need for fish. These rolls are made with nori seaweed sheets, filled with julienned vegetables, and served with a soy-free dipping sauce.
5. Raw Vegan Pad Thai: This popular Thai dish gets a raw vegan twist by using spiralized or julienned vegetables instead of noodles. Tossed in a tangy sauce made from almond butter, lime juice, and tamari.
6. Raw Vegan Energy Balls: These no-bake treats are perfect for a quick energy boost. Made from a mixture of nuts, dates, and superfoods like chia seeds or goji berries, they are packed with nutrients.
7. Raw Vegan Green Smoothie: Start your day with a nutritious green smoothie made from leafy greens, fruits, and a liquid base like coconut water or almond milk. It’s a refreshing way to get your daily dose of vitamins and minerals.
8. Raw Vegan Cashew Cheese: If you’re missing cheese on your raw vegan journey, this recipe is a game-changer. It uses soaked cashews blended with nutritional yeast, lemon juice, and seasonings to create a creamy and flavorful cheese alternative.
9. Raw Vegan Banana Ice Cream: Craving ice cream? Look no further! Blend frozen bananas with your favorite fruits or flavorings like cocoa powder or vanilla extract, and you’ll have a delicious and healthy frozen treat.

Q1. Is it necessary to soak nuts and seeds before using them in raw vegan recipes?
A1. Soaking nuts and seeds helps to remove enzyme inhibitors and make them easier to digest. It is recommended but not always necessary.
Q2. Can I eat raw vegan food every day?
A2. Yes, you can. Many people follow a raw vegan diet as their primary way of eating, while others incorporate raw meals into their regular diet.
Q3. Are raw vegan recipes suitable for children?
A3. Raw vegan recipes can be a healthy option for children, but it’s important to ensure they are getting all the necessary nutrients for their growth and development.
Q4. Can I lose weight on a raw vegan diet?
A4. Many people find that they naturally lose weight on a raw vegan diet due to its emphasis on whole, unprocessed foods. However, it’s essential to maintain a balanced and varied diet.
Q5. Are raw vegan recipes expensive to make?
A5. While some raw vegan ingredients can be pricey, there are also plenty of affordable options like fruits, vegetables, nuts, and seeds. It all depends on your choices and budget.
Q6. Can I use a regular blender or food processor for raw vegan recipes?
A6. Yes, a regular blender or food processor can be used for most raw vegan recipes. However, high-speed blenders like Vitamix or Blendtec are often recommended for smoother textures.
